  • Background

    Established in 1963 from the left maxilla of a 12-year-old African boy with Burkitt's lymphoma, it is the first continuous human hematopoietic cell line. It has become an indispensable tool in haematological research and leukaemia and lymphoma studies.

Question

Dear technical support team: The customer raised an enquiry about ab30124, ab30125, ab30126 this customer wants to know which one is more suitable and could be a positive control of ab52610 (Anti-PLCG 2 (phospho Y1217) antibody [EP1404Y])? According to the online datasheet, the wb result shows “Lane 2: Raji cell lysate with pervanadate”, therefore, she wants to know how to prepare this sample? Could you please offer any suggestion to her? Thanks for your kindly help Best regards

Read More

Abcam community

Verified customer

Asked on Feb 09 2012

Answer

Thank you for your enquiry regarding ab52610.

The phosphorylation of PLCG 2 at Tyrosine 1217 needs to be induced to be able to detect this specific modification. As the WB image on the datasheet indicates Raji cell lysate without stimulation will not provide signal for phospho Y1217. It is important to treat the cells with inducer such as pervanadate.

Question

We are trying to develop a teaching lab in which students would purify monoclonal antibodies from a cell line, and then verify/quantify their purification by ELISA.   The hybridoma that we have is L243, (produces anti-human MHC class 2), so we are now looking for a source for purified MHC class 2 in order to complete the ELISA.   I found a paper which describes a protocol for purifying MHC class 2 from Raji cells, however we currently do not have this cell line so I was thinking that perhaps if we could find Raji whole cell lysate we may  be able to use it instead.   In the paper I found, a total of 10^7 Raji cells were digested with papain to release surface proteins.  Protease inhibitor is then added and the cells are pelleted leaving the MHC class 2 in the supernatant.  This is followed by dialysis and then the MHC2 protein is conjugated to NHS-activated Sepharose affinity resin.   My questions regarding using the Raji cell lysate are:   -In obtaining the lysate are surface/membrane proteins released and therefore within the lysate itself…..i.e. is there any possibility the surface/membrane proteins are lost from the lysate, (could they still be stuck in the cell membrane which could potentially get spun out and removed from the lysate)?   -How many cells are you starting with in order to get the 100ug of lysate?  The paper that I am trying to adapt is digesting 10^7 Raji cells.   Thank you for any help you can offer.

Read More

Abcam community

Verified customer

Asked on Dec 14 2011

Answer

Thank you for contacting Abcam Our protein lysate is called total protein lysate, which means most of the proteins, including membrane and surface proteins, are within the lysate. We don’t really have a cell number to generate 100ug lysate, we can only estimate in this way, assuming 125 million cells as 5 g, and usually there is about 10% lysate, so 500 mg /125million cells, then 100 ug lysate is estimated from 25,000 cells. I have also attached the Abcam protocols book that contains a section on choosing the correct lysis buffer, when trying to capture different parts of the cell.
